Alibaba treats automated access to its supplier and product pages as a threat to its infrastructure and its data, so it applies aggressive defenses. Send too many requests from one IP and you will quickly meet rate limits, CAPTCHAs, throttling, or outright blocks that halt a catalog crawl mid-run. Even modest research at scale, checking a few hundred supplier profiles or tracking prices across a product category, trips these thresholds fast. Alibaba proxies distribute your requests across a large pool of IP addresses, so no single address carries a suspicious load and your collection stays under the radar. Proxies also address a subtler problem: Alibaba shows region-varying content, including different suppliers, currencies, shipping estimates, and promotions depending on where the visitor appears to be. Without geographically diverse IPs you only ever see one slice of the marketplace. Using proxies for Alibaba lets you research the platform as buyers in different regions actually experience it, which is essential for accurate sourcing and pricing intelligence. What sourcing pros use Alibaba proxies for
Legitimate sourcing and procurement work drives most demand for Alibaba proxies. Supplier and product research is the core use case: teams scrape supplier profiles, certifications, product specs, review histories, and trade-assurance signals to shortlist vendors and vet them before placing orders. Price and MOQ monitoring is another staple, buyers track how unit prices, tiered pricing, and minimum order quantities shift over time and across competing suppliers, so they can time purchases and negotiate from data rather than guesswork. Catalog scraping supports large-scale product research, letting merchandisers and importers pull thousands of listings to map categories, spot trending products, and build internal sourcing databases. Regional sourcing rounds out the picture: because Alibaba tailors results by location, buyers use geo-distributed proxies to compare supplier availability and landed-cost estimates across markets, uncovering better options than a single vantage point would reveal. Rotating residential pools make these high-volume, multi-page crawls practical without constant blocks. Managing multiple buyer accounts for different brands or regions is a further use, provided it complies with Alibaba's account policies.
Best proxy type for Alibaba + how to choose
For Alibaba, residential proxies are the strongest default. They route traffic through real consumer IP addresses, so requests look like genuine buyer sessions and survive Alibaba's blocking far longer than datacenter traffic on heavy use. Rotating residential pools are ideal for large catalog crawls and price monitoring, cycling IPs automatically so no single address accumulates a suspicious request volume. Datacenter proxies are cheaper and faster, and they can work for light, low-frequency lookups, but Alibaba fingerprints and blocks datacenter ranges quickly once volume rises, making them unreliable for sustained scraping. When choosing a provider, weigh pool size and IP diversity, geographic coverage in the regions you source from, rotation controls, and whether sticky sessions are available for tasks that need a stable identity across several page loads. Consider bandwidth pricing since residential proxies bill by usage, plus success rates against B2B marketplaces and quality of support. Match your budget to volume, then throttle requests, respect Alibaba's Terms of Service, and collect only what you legitimately need.
